My wife and I ate at Martin's Bar-B-Que Joint for the first time today, and we have found our new favorite BBQ joint. We enjoy watching Pat Martin's tv show, "Life of Fire," so we came with very high expectations. They surpassed them. When we stepped out of the car the smoke BBQ smell was amazing. I ordered a pulled pork shoulder sandwich and asked them to top it with coleslaw and had a side of mac & cheese and bought a second side, cornbread hoecake. Martha ordered the sliced brisket sandwich with a side of baked beans. I started with the mac & cheese. It was delicious with plenty of cheese and baked to perfection with a crispy cheese top. Really delicious. The cornbread hoecake was incredible it looks like and has the consistency of a pancake. You must order that when you go. Then I picked up the pulled pork shoulder sandwich and sunk my teeth in it. Oh, my! Pulled pork at its best. I added the Jack's Creek vinegar-based sauce to it, and wow, that added even more outstanding flavor to it. I've found my new favorite BBQ sauce. Martha thoroughly enjoyed her sliced brisket sandwich. We both had a bite of each others sandwiches and both were mouth-satisfying delicious. The brisket was perfect. The baked beans were very tasty, too. Everything was about as perfect as you can get at a BBQ joint. Pat Martin knows his BBQ, just as he displays on his show "Life of Fire." Before I could say anything, Martha said, "This is the best BBQ I've ever had. Let's come back for lunch tomorrow." She didn't have to twist my arm. We still like many other delicious BBQ restaurants in Birmingham, and will eat at them again, but Martin's Bar-B-Que Joint is our new favorite. In a city where BBQ is king, Martin's Bar-B-Que Joint sits atop the throne. We returned the next day for lunch. : Martha enjoyed the mouth watering and mouth satisfying Pulled Pork Sandwich topped with coleslaw and deliciously seasoned and crisp homemade chips. I threw down on a half slab of fall off the bone full flavored ribs. I got half of the ribs Memphis dry rub and the other half wet (St. Louis style). They were amazing! My sides were broccoli salad (because I'm a health nut) and homemade fries. And, of course, the delicious cornbread hoecake. We can't wait to come back to B'ham again to try more delicious food here at Martin's Bar-B-Que Joint.
